日日爱影视_日本一区二区三区日本免费_大香焦伊人在钱8_欧美一级夜夜爽 - 日韩三级视频在线观看

當前位置:首頁 ? 做APP ? 正文

用h5開發app方法有哪幾種?

H5開發App的方法有很多,其中最常用的是基于H5的混合開發。混合開發使用HTML5、CSS3、JavaScript等Web技術,結合原生移動應用的方法,完成應用界面和功能的開發,可以有效降低開發成本,同時也可以提高開發的效率。

一、混合開發原理

混合開發是將移動應用的前端界面部分使用Web技術開發,后端則使用原生移動應用的方式實現。在移動應用開發中,原生應用開發可以使用Java、Swift、Objective-C等語言開發,而前端則可以使用HTML5、CSS3、JavaScript等Web技術開發。

混合開發的關鍵是WebView技術。WebView是原生應用中嵌入網頁的控件,通過WebView,可以實現對H5頁面的加載和渲染。同時也可以在H5頁面中調用原生應用的API接口,從而

實現原生應用與H5頁面的互動。

二、混合開發開發工具

1. HBuilder:HBuilder是一款非常優秀的H5開發工具,它提供了完整的混合開發環境,包括代碼編輯、調試、實時預覽等功能。HBuilder支持Android、iOS、Windows Phone等平臺的應用開發。

2. PhoneGap:PhoneGap是一款支持多平臺的混合開發框架,它支持HTML、CSS、JavaScript等Web技術開發移動應用。PhoneGap提供了許多API和插件,可以實現原生應用的功能,比如獲取設備信息、加速計、攝像頭、文件系統等。PhoneGap開發的應用可以發布到多個平臺,包括Android、iOS、Windows Phone等。

3. Ionic:Ionic是一款基于AngularJS和Cordovapp基于h5開發a的混合開發框架。它提供了大量的組件和樣式,可以快速開發出美觀且功能強大的應用。Ionic支持Android、iOS等平臺的應用開發。

4. Weex:Weex是一款支持Vue.js的混合開發框架,可以使用Vue.js開發應用,將應用打包成原生應用。Weex使用JavaScript和Vue.js在原生應用中渲染頁面,同時還可以訪問原生API接口,提供原生應用的功能支持。

三、混合開發注意事項

1. 避免UI風格過于HTML5風格:移動應用設計美觀性很重要,用戶更喜歡原生風格的應用,而不是HTML5風格的應用。因此,在混合開發中,需要注意應用的UI設計,盡量讓應用看起來更像原生應用。

2. 處理WebView的缺陷:由于WebView是嵌入在原生應用中的,因app制作h5此其性能和穩定性可能會受到影響。開發人員需要針對WebView的缺陷進行優化,提高應用的性能和穩定性。

3. 掌握原生API和插件接口:在混合開發中,需要使用到原生API和插件接口,因此需要掌握相關的API和插件接口。開發人員需要熟悉不同平臺的API和插件接口,以便能夠快速地實現應用的功能。

四、總結

H5開發App的方法,主要是使用混合開發的方式來實現。混合開發使用HTML5、CSS3、JavaScript等Web技術結合原生移動應用的方式,可以實現應用界面和功能的開發。在混合開發中,需要注意UI設計、WebView缺陷和原生API和插件接口的掌握,以提高應用的性能和穩定性。

未經允許不得轉載:http://www.glwnet.com/智電網絡 ? 用h5開發app方法有哪幾種?

相關推薦

推薦欄目